Interesting Facts

  • The modern Indonesian language uses many loan words from Persian, Chinese and Arabic.
  • In Indonesian language, spelling is phonetically precise, so that words are spelled as they sound.
  • There is no space left between words, only between phrases or sentences in Lao language.
  • The Lao alphabets has been reformed many times over the past 50 years.

Indonesian and Lao Language History

Comparison of Indonesian vs Lao language history gives us differences between origin of Indonesian and Lao language. History of Indonesian language states that this language originated in 7th Century whereas history of Lao language states that this language originated in 1283 CE.
